Output 24063caba1e4e88c1efd5f5c908a140d05d5a3ba72dfcc865da89f1aabaf2b49:0

value
1712300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c18b273646f01ae101c164d12f3dfe6cd35ca1a OP_EQUALVERIFY OP_CHECKSIG
address
1DmmBqfNF27DB6XJYgCWzcyeD32jJy3YGw
transaction
24063caba1e4e88c1efd5f5c908a140d05d5a3ba72dfcc865da89f1aabaf2b49
confirmations
506893
spent
true